区块链技术如何确保交易数据的安全性和完整性?
区块链技术通过多种机制确保数据的安全性和完整性,使其在各类业务和应用中广受欢迎。它的基本特征之一就是去中心化,这意味着数据不再存储在单一的中心服务器上,而是被分布在多个节点之间。每个节点都拥有完整的账本副本,这使得伪造或篡改数据变得非常困难。恶意攻击者必须同时控制网络中的大量节点才能对数据进行操控。
在区块链中,数据以区块的形式进行存储,每个区块包含一定数量的交易信息。这些区块通过密码学算法连接在一起,形成链条。每个区块中都嵌入了前一个区块的哈希值,这种结构不仅防止了数据的篡改,也确保了数据的完整性。如果试图更改某个区块的数据,哈希值将发生变化,导致下一个区块失去有效性。因此,数据总是以不可篡改的方式被保留。
密码学在区块链中起着至关重要的作用。每个参与者在网络中都有独特的公钥和私钥,公钥用于生成地址,而私钥则用于签名和验证交易。只有拥有私钥的人才能对数据进行操作,这使得交易的安全性得到了极大的提升。当一个交易被发起时,它会被签名,从而确保了交易的确是由合法的持有者发起的。签名还保证了交易内容不被篡改。
共识机制是"https://www.chainsafeai.com/" title="区块链安全">区块链安全性的另一个关键要素。为了在去中心化网络中达成一致意见,不同的区块链采用了不同的共识算法。一些较常见的机制包括工作量证明和权益证明。这些机制确保了网络中所有节点对账本状态的一致性,从而防止了对账本的篡改。通过要求节点进行复杂的计算或通过持有的权益来获得参与权,共识机制增强了网络的安全性。
去中心化的特点使得任何用户都可以参与网络,也能审计和验证交易。任何用户都可以查看整个链的历史记录,确保信息透明且可追溯。这种开放性加深了对数据合法性的信任,因而降低了信任成本。同时,用户也能自主选择信任的节点,而不必依赖单一实体,这本身就是一种强有力的保障。
不受中央机构控制的特性,使得区块链能够抵抗许多形式的攻击,例如拒绝服务攻击和数据窃取。即使某个节点出现故障或被攻击,整个网络仍然可以正常运行,因其余节点拥有完整的数据副本。任何单一节点的失效都不会影响到系统的整体功能,这样一来,数据的可用性也得到了保障。
区块链的设计原则同样关注于用户隐私和数据保护。用户的信息通过加密技术进行保护,不同的区块链通过不同的机制实现隐私管理。例如,一些系统允许用户匿名交易,而另一些则允许用户通过控制谁可以看到特定数据来保护隐私。这种灵活性,使得区块链能够满足不同场景下对隐私需求的多样性。
审计和合规性也是区块链的一个显著特征。由于所有交易都是透明和不可篡改的,审计过程变得更加清晰、简单和高效。监管机构可以实时访问数据,以确保合规性。这一特性对于那些需要遵循严格法规的领域显得尤为重要,例如金融服务、供应链管理和医疗保健等。
随着技术的发展,区块链的安全性和完整性也在不断提升。区块链社区对安全性问题高度重视,定期进行"https://www.chainsafeai.com/" title="安全审计">安全审计和测试,以识别潜在的漏洞和改进点。随着新一代链技术的诞生,许多项目正致力于提高速度和效率的同时保持安全性。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能"https://www.chainsafeai.com/" title="合约审计">合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。